Jerky, sauces, jams and meal pouches from Welsh producers.
Cowleys Fine Foods in Trealaw makes preserved foods and snacks, with jerky at the front of the range alongside biltong, chilli sauces, fruit leathers and jams including bacon jam.
FEI Foods in South Wales makes microwaveable foods in pouch and pot formats, with ambient porridge pots alongside pouches for rice, grains, pasta and lentils.
Matsudai Ramen makes ramen kits in South Wales under the Matsudai name.
ToppDogz Craft Syrups in Abercynon makes small-batch syrups in fruit, sweet-shop and cocktail-inspired flavours.
